                                  A RESOLUTION

     1  Memorializing the Citizens' Stamp Advisory Committee of the
     2     United States Postal Service Board of Governors to issue a
     3     stamp designed to promote child care.

     4     WHEREAS, Child care has become an important element in family
     5  life in this Commonwealth and throughout the nation; therefore
     6  be it
     7     R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ives memorialize the
     8  Citizen's Stamp Advisory Committee of the United States Postal
     9  Service Board of Governors to issue a stamp designed to promote
    10  child care.
